Hypertension is a major global health problem with increasing prevalence and high risk of complications if not properly managed. One of the key factors influencing relapse prevention in hypertensive patients is family support. This study aimed to analyze the relationship between family support and relapse prevention efforts among patients with hypertension in Cikembar Village, Sukabumi Regency. The research employed a quantitative approach with a descriptive correlational design and cross-sectional method. A total of 288 respondents were selected using stratified random sampling. Data were collected using structured questionnaires, namely the Endrichd Social Support Instrument (ESSI) and the Hypertension Prevention Practices Questionnaire (HPPQ), and analyzed using chi-square statistical tests. The results showed that most respondents had supportive family environments (69.4%) and good relapse prevention practices (61.5%). Statistical analysis revealed a significant relationship between family support and relapse prevention efforts (p-value = 0.000). These findings indicate that strong family support plays an important role in improving patients’ adherence to healthy lifestyles and treatment plans. The study implies that health services should strengthen family-based interventions and educational programs to enhance hypertension management and reduce relapse risks.
